- Избавляемся от проблемы запуска службы PostgresSQL в несколько простых шагов
- Как решить проблему с запуском службы PostgreSQL?
- Проверка файлов службы
- Проверка конфигурации
- Перезагрузка сервера
- Не запускается служба PostgreSQL — что делать?
- Четверг, 31 декабря 2009 г.
- Перезагрузка PostgreSQL
- Восстановление исполняемых файлов
- Дополнительная информация
- Programming stuff для ОС Windows
- Почему может не запускаться служба Postgres?
- 1. Некорректное завершение работы службы
- 2. Отсутствие необходимых DLL-библиотек
- Дополнительная информация
- Служба не запускается: есть сообщения об ошибках, отсутствуют исполняемые файлы и DLL-библиотеки СУБД, некорректное завершение работы службы
- Страницы
- Видео:
- Исправление кодировки в psql на Windows
Избавляемся от проблемы запуска службы PostgresSQL в несколько простых шагов
Windows является одной из самых популярных операционных систем, и поэтому неудивительно, что многие пользователи сталкиваются с проблемами при запуске службы PostgresSQL. В этой статье мы рассмотрим, почему это происходит и как можно решить эту проблему.
В некоторых случаях служба PostgresSQL может не запускаться из-за некорректных настроек или некорретного программного обеспечения. Если вы столкнулись с подобной проблемой, вам может пригодиться следующая информация.
Во-первых, убедитесь, что все файлы, необходимые для работы службы PostgresSQL, находятся на своих местах. Это включает в себя исполняемые файлы, dll-библиотеки и конфигурационные файлы. Если какой-то из этих файлов отсутствует или поврежден, это может вызвать ошибки при запуске службы.
Дополнительная информация может быть получена из сообщений, сформированных службой PostgresSQL. Проверьте, есть ли какие-либо предупреждения или ошибки, связанные с запуском службы, в журнале событий Windows.
Как решить проблему с запуском службы PostgreSQL?
Если вы столкнулись с проблемой запуска службы PostgreSQL на своем сервере, то в этой статье мы рассмотрим несколько возможных решений. При запуске службы PostgresSQL вы можете получить сообщение об ошибке, которое указывает на причину, почему служба не запускается. Ошибка может быть связана с отсутствием каких-либо файлов или dll-библиотек, некорректным исполняемым файлом или неправильно сформированной конфигурацией.
Проверка файлов службы
Первая вещь, которую нужно проверить, — наличие необходимых файлов для запуска службы PostgreSQL. Убедитесь, что все необходимые файлы находятся в правильных директориях. Обычно, файлы связанные с PostgresSQL находятся в папке «Program Files», в подпапке «PostgreSQL». Вы можете также проверить, есть ли какие-либо файлы ошибок или сообщений, которые могут указывать на причину запускающихся проблем.
Проверка конфигурации
Если файлы и библиотеки присутствуют, следующим шагом будет проверка конфигурационных файлов. Убедитесь, что конфигурационные файлы службы PostgreSQL правильно сформированы и не содержат некорректных данных. Проверьте наличие информации о правильном порту, пути к файлам баз данных и другую конфигурацию.
Перезагрузка сервера
Иногда, перезагрузка сервера может помочь решить проблему с запуском службы. Попробуйте перезагрузить сервер и затем повторите попытку запуска службы PostgresSQL. Это может помочь в случае, если проблема была вызвана временными сбоями или конфликтами.
В случае, если ни одно из вышеперечисленных решений не помогло, возможно, вам потребуется обратиться к программистам или разработчикам PostgreSQL для получения дополнительной помощи. Они смогут вам предоставить более точные рекомендации, основанные на вашей конкретной ситуации и сообщениях об ошибках.
Не запускается служба PostgreSQL — что делать?
Если вы используете сервер баз данных PostgreSQL (Postgres) и столкнулись с проблемой, когда служба не запускается, в данной статье мы рассмотрим возможные решения этой проблемы.
Причины, по которым служба PostgreSQL может не запускаться, могут быть различными. Вот несколько шагов, которые вы можете предпринять для решения данной проблемы:
- Проверьте, работает ли служба PostgresSQL в данный момент. Для этого откройте «Менеджер сервисов» в Windows (нажмите Win + R, введите services.msc и нажмите Enter). Ищите службу с названием «postgresql-x64-12» (номер версии может отличаться) в списке служб и проверьте ее текущий статус.
- Если служба PostgreSQL не запускается после перезагрузки сервера, убедитесь, что у вас нет других служб или программ, которые могут запускаться автоматически при включении компьютера и конфликтовать с PostgreSQL.
- Проверьте наличие ошибок запуска PostgreSQL в журналах событий Windows. Откройте «Журнал событий» (нажмите Win + R, введите eventvwr и нажмите Enter), выберите «Журналы Windows» и затем «Система». Обратите внимание на сообщения об ошибках, связанных с запуском службы PostgreSQL, и попробуйте найти причину их возникновения.
- Проверьте соответствие исполняемых файлов PostgreSQL, а также файлов баз данных. Убедитесь, что все необходимые файлы присутствуют и не повреждены.
- Проверьте правильность установки PostgreSQL. Убедитесь, что вы следовали всем инструкциям по установке и настройке PostgreSQL, включая правильное указание пути к директории с исполняемыми файлами.
- При наличии сообщений об ошибках на экране или в файле журнала PostgreSQL, сравните эти сообщения с документацией по PostgreSQL или выполните поиск в Интернете, чтобы найти решение для конкретной ошибки.
Если после выполнения указанных выше шагов проблема все еще не решена, рекомендуется обратиться к сообществу пользователей PostgreSQL или к специалистам по базам данных для получения дополнительной помощи в решении данной проблемы.
Четверг, 31 декабря 2009 г.
Если при запуске службы PostgresSQL вы столкнулись с ошибками или сервер аварийно завершил работу, то может возникнуть необходимость вручную запустить службу.
В случае отсутствия информации о причинах аварийного завершения работы PostgreSQL, вы можете попробовать запустить службу вручную, следуя последовательно указанным инструкциям:
Перезагрузка PostgreSQL
1. Если служба уже запущена, необходимо ее выключить. Для этого выполните команду:
net stop postgresql-x64-12
2. Затем запустите службу снова с помощью следующей команды:
net start postgresql-x64-12
Если после выполнения данных шагов служба запускается без ошибок, то проблема с запуском службы должна быть исправлена.
Восстановление исполняемых файлов
Если служба все равно не запускается или вы получаете сообщения об ошибках, то причина может быть в некорректных или поврежденных DLL-библиотеках. Для исправления этой проблемы выполните следующие действия:
1. Перейдите в каталог, где установлен PostgreSQL. Обычно это: C:\Program Files\PostgreSQL\версия_поставленной_субд\bin.
2. Скопируйте все файлы с расширением .dll и .exe из указанного каталога в новую папку на рабочем столе или в какое-либо другое место.
Дополнительная информация
В случае, если служба PostgreSQL все равно не запускается или вы продолжаете получать сообщения об ошибках, рекомендуется обратиться к документации по PostgreSQL или обратиться за помощью к специалистам по работе с этой СУБД.
Некорректное функционирование службы PostgreSQL может быть связано с различными факторами, включая проблемы на стороне операционной системы Windows, неправильные настройки или повреждение важных файлов.
Основываясь на сформированной информации об ошибках и сообщениях, вы постепенно можете выявить причины некорректной работы PostgresSQL и принять меры по их устранению.
Programming stuff для ОС Windows
Если у вас возникла проблема с запуском службы PostgresSQL, то в этом разделе вы найдете полезную информацию о том, почему она может не запускаться, что делать в случае некорретного завершения работы службы, а также как запустить службу после перезагрузки операционной системы Windows.
Во-первых, убедитесь, что у вас установлена последняя версия PostgreSQL для Windows. Вы можете скачать соответствующий дистрибутив с официального сайта PostgreSQL.
Во-вторых, проверьте, что все необходимые файлы и DLL-библиотеки для работы PostgreSQL находятся в правильных директориях. Обычно файлы располагаются в папке «C:\Program Files\PostgreSQL», а DLL-библиотеки — в папке «C:\Program Files\PostgreSQL\bin». Если какие-то файлы отсутствуют или находятся в неправильном месте, это может привести к ошибкам запуска службы.
В-четвертых, убедитесь, что служба PostgreSQL правильно настроена для запуска автоматически после перезагрузки операционной системы. Для этого откройте окно «Службы» (нажмите клавиши «Win + R», введите «services.msc» и нажмите Enter), найдите службу «postgresql-x64-12» или аналогичную для вашей версии PostgreSQL, откройте ее свойства и установите опцию «Тип запуска» в значение «Автоматически».
В-пятых, если вы столкнулись с проблемой запуска службы после аварийного завершения работы сервера PostgreSQL, то следует удалить временные файлы, созданные сервером, чтобы предотвратить возможные конфликты. Очистите папку «C:\Program Files\PostgreSQL\data» от всех файлов, кроме папки «pg_log». Затем попробуйте снова запустить службу.
Если все вышеперечисленные действия не помогли решить проблему запуска службы PostgreSQL, то рекомендуется обратиться за дополнительной информацией к разработчикам PostgreSQL или посетить официальную страницу поддержки на сайте postgresql.org.
В итоге, при следовании данной информации вы сможете успешно запустить и использовать службу PostgresSQL на операционной системе Windows без каких-либо проблем.
Почему может не запускаться служба Postgres?
При работе с PostgreSQL может возникнуть ситуация, когда служба сервера баз данных не запускается. В этом случае может быть несколько причин, почему так происходит.
1. Некорректное завершение работы службы
Если служба PostgreSQL была выключена аварийно, то при следующем запуске может возникнуть проблема с запуском. В этом случае необходимо выполнить дополнительные действия для восстановления работы службы.
2. Отсутствие необходимых DLL-библиотек
Для правильного запуска службы PostgreSQL требуются определенные DLL-библиотеки. Если эти файлы отсутствуют или исполняемые файлы PostgreSQL не могут найти их, то запуск службы может быть невозможен.
Что делать в случае проблем с запуском службы PostgresSQL в операционной системе Windows? Во-первых, стоит проверить наличие необходимых DLL-библиотек и их пути, а также права доступа к ним. Если какие-то файлы отсутствуют или некорректны, то их нужно заменить или переустановить.
В некоторых случаях может быть полезно включить режим аварийного запуска службы PostgreSQL, чтобы получить более подробную информацию о возможных проблемах. Для этого можно добавить определенные параметры запуска в конфигурационный файл сервера (например, postgresql.conf).
Особое внимание следует также уделить версиям PostgreSQL и компонентов операционной системы. Некорректная совместимость может стать причиной неработоспособности службы. Убедитесь, что версии PostgreSQL и требуемых компонентов соответствуют друг другу.
В случае, если все вышеперечисленные действия не помогли запустить службу PostgreSQL, рекомендуется обратиться за помощью к специалистам или обратиться к сообществу разработчиков PostgreSQL.
Дополнительная информация
В случае, если служба PostgresSQL не запускается последовательно после запуска операционной системы Windows, или при попытке запустить службу возникают ошибки, есть несколько дополнительных вещей, которые можно делать для работы с этой СУБД:
- Убедитесь, что все исполняемые файлы PostgreSQL (postgresql-x64-12.dll-библиотеки и т. Д.) находятся в рабочем каталоге службы.
- Проверьте страницы с сообщениями службы, которые могут быть сформированы после запуска PostgreSQL.
- После перезагрузки сервера Postgres может не запуститься аварийным образом. Обычно ошибка связана с некорректным порядком запуска служб или зависимостей между службами.
- В случае отсутствия информации об ошибках в службе Postgres, просмотрите журналы событий Windows, чтобы выявить возможные проблемы.
- Убедитесь, что служба Postgres запускается от имени пользователя с достаточными правами доступа к файлам и каталогам, связанным с Postgres.
- Проверьте, что все зависимости для работы службы Postgres установлены и функционируют корректно. Это могут быть другие службы и программные компоненты, необходимые для работы PostgresSQL.
- Проверьте, что вы используете последнюю стабильную версию PostgreSQL. Иногда обновление программного обеспечения помогает избежать проблем, которые были исправлены в новых версиях.
- Не забывайте, что здесь нет одного универсального решения для всех проблем с запуском службы PostgresSQL. У каждой проблемы могут быть свои конкретные причины и решения. В случае серьезных ошибок или невозможности запустить службу, рекомендуется обратиться к документации, форумам или специалистам по PostgreSQL.
Служба не запускается: есть сообщения об ошибках, отсутствуют исполняемые файлы и DLL-библиотеки СУБД, некорректное завершение работы службы
Если служба PostgreSQL не запускается на вашей системе Windows, это может быть вызвано разными причинами. Здесь будут рассмотрены некоторые возможные проблемы, которые могут возникнуть.
Один из возможных вариантов — отсутствие необходимых исполняемых файлов и библиотек PostgreSQL. В случае, когда служба не запускается, проверьте, что все требуемые файлы и DLL-библиотеки PostgreSQL находятся в их месте.
Также, возможно, в системе присутствуют сообщения об ошибках, которые могут указывать на проблемы с запуском службы PostgreSQL. Просмотрите информацию об ошибках и обратите внимание на необходимые действия для их исправления.
Если служба PostgreSQL не запускается из-за некорректного завершения работы службы, то нужно выполнить следующие действия:
- Перезагрузите сервер
- После перезагрузки выполните запуск службы PostgreSQL
В некоторых случаях возможно появление сообщений об ошибках после аварийного выключения сервера. В таком случае необходимо следовать инструкциям для их устранения.
В итоге, если служба PostgreSQL не запускается и вы столкнулись со всеми вышеописанными проблемами, вам следует приступить к их решению поочередно, чтобы устранить возникшие проблемы и успешно запустить службу.
Страницы
При запуске службы PostgresSQL может возникать ряд проблем, которые могут приводить к аварийному завершению работы сервера. Одна из таких проблем может быть связана с отсутствием необходимых файлов или некорректной установкой PostgreSQL.
Если после перезагрузки Windows служба PostgreSQL не запускается автоматически, то стоит проверить наличие необходимых файлов. Исполняемые файлы платформы PostgreSQL, такие как «postgres.exe» и «pg_ctl.exe», должны быть расположены в директории, указанной в переменной среды «PATH».
Также следует обратить внимание на наличие сообщений об ошибках. При запуске службы PostgreSQL в журнале событий Windows могут появляться сообщения об ошибках или предупреждениях. В случае обнаружения подобных сообщений, необходимо обратиться к дополнительной информации о возможных причинах и способах их устранения.
Если служба PostgreSQL запускается, но после некоторого времени аварийно завершается, то возможно, проблема кроется в некорректной работе дополнительных dll-библиотек. Для выявления конкретной причины выключения службы необходимо проанализировать журналы событий Windows.
Еще одной возможной причиной проблем с запуском службы PostgreSQL может быть некорретное завершение работы PostgreSQL в предыдущем сеансе. В таком случае необходимо выполнить дополнительное действие — удалить каталог «postmaster.pid» из основной директории PostgreSQL.
Для запуска службы PostgreSQL вручную необходимо открыть командную строку в режиме администратора и выполнить команду «pg_ctl.exe start». После успешного запуска службы можно убедиться в правильной работе PostgreSQL, открыв веб-страницу «http://localhost:5432/» в браузере.
Видео:
Исправление кодировки в psql на Windows
Исправление кодировки в psql на Windows автор: Roman Chumakov 1 361 перегляд 9 місяців тому 4 хвилини і 16 секунд